The Bataclan is a "salle de spectacle" at 50 boulevard Voltaire in the 11th arrondissement of Paris. It was built in 1864 by the architect Charles Duval. Its name refers to Ba-Ta-Clan, an operetta by Offenbach, but is also wordplay on the expression le tout bataclan (the whole caboodle; oldest written source is a journal entry of 11 Nov 1761 by Favart, predating Offenbach). The nearest métro stations are Oberkampf on Line 5 and Line 9 and Filles du Calvaire on Line 8.
